Andrew Cohen
Andrew Cohen, founder of EnlightenNext, is an
internationally respected spiritual teacher, cultural
critic, and evolutionary philosopher widely recognized as
a defining voice in the emerging field of evolutionary
spirituality. A life-changing awakening in 1986 brought
Cohen to the end of his own search for liberation while
simultaneously starting him on an exploration of the
meaning and significance of enlightenment for our time.
In 1992, Cohen released the first issue of the
award-winning magazine EnlightenNext (formerly What Is
Enlightenment?), pioneering an innovative form of
spiritual journalism reminiscent of classical Socratic
dialogue. In its forty-plus issues, Cohen has brought
together leading thinkers, mystics and materialists,
philosophers and psychologists to call for a higher and
wholly contemporary synthesis of the spiritual truths
found in the East and the empirical rigor of the West.
Together with a growing network of "evolutionaries" and
integral visionaries, he is helping to define a culture
of thought that places spiritual transformation at the
center of any vision of transforming the world. In 2009,
Cohen launched the EnlightenNext Discovery Cycle, an
integrated program of spiritual retreats, conferences,
